Border 2 surpasses Rs 464 crore worldwide on day 19

The Sunny Deol and Varun Dhawan starrer Border 2 has crossed Rs 464 crore in worldwide box office collections by its 19th day. On day 19, the film earned an estimated Rs 3.29 crore in India, marking a 64.50% increase from the previous day. This performance indicates steady weekday interest despite nearing the end of its run.

Border 2, the sequel featuring Sunny Deol and Varun Dhawan, continued its box office journey on its 19th day, Tuesday, with an overall Hindi occupancy of 13.59%. The day's attendance began at 6.28% for morning shows, rose to 11.96% in the afternoon, reached 15.19% in the evening, and peaked at 20.94% for night screenings. This gradual increase suggests stronger viewer turnout in later hours.

Early estimates from trade site Sacnilk show that on day 18, the third Monday, collections dropped sharply to Rs 2 crore, a 72.41% decline from the day before. However, day 19 saw a rebound with Rs 3.29 crore, reflecting a 64.50% growth and renewed audience engagement during the weekday.

Trade analyst Vishek Chauhan commented on social media: "@iamsunnydeol didn’t change. The market did. #border2 crossing ₹300cr+ wasn’t just a sequel win. It was a signal: theatrical taste has completed a cycle."

By this point, the film has amassed over Rs 464 crore globally, highlighting its sustained appeal in theaters.
